B-Meson Wavefunction in the Wandzura-Wilczek Approximation
Abstract
The B-meson wavefunction has been studied with the help of the vacuum-to-meson matrix element of the nonlocal operators in the heavy quark effective theory. In order to obtain the Wandzura-Wilczek-type B-meson wavefunction, we solve the equations which are derived from the equation of motion of the light spectator quark in the B meson by using two different assumptions.
